Farmer Jones raises ducks and cows. He looks out his window and sees 54 animals with a total of 122 feet. If each animal is "nor
Readme [11.4K]

Answer:

47 ducks and 7 cows

Step-by-step explanation:

Ducks have 2 legs and cows have 4 legs.

If all the animals are ducks,

number of legs= 54(2)= 108

Difference in number of legs= 122 -108= 14

Difference in no. of legs per animal= 4 -2 = 2

Number of cows=14 ÷2 = 7

Number of ducks= 54-7= 47

Thus, he have 47 ducks and 7 cows.

Let's check:

Total number of feet= 7(4)+ 47(2) = 122 ✓

You could also first assume that all the animals are cows. The answer would be the same.
